A Study of Chateau sur Mer Report I: The Wetmore Family and Their Domestics
Holly Collins

A detailed account of a Victorian household and its domestic staff as seen in Wetmore family letters. I. An Overview of Victorian Newport Society..................................................1-5 The servant as a vehicle of distinction Staff hierarchies The domestic paradox
II. The William Shepard Wetmore Family and their Domestics...........................6-12 Merchant career The early years at Chateau sur Mer In between years
III. The George Peabody Wetmore Family and their Domestics..........................13-27 A Victorian “Man of Letters” Marriage and family Chateau sur Mer’s new service wing and staff Hiring servants The all-important footman How the Wetmores entertained A dinner party How the staff entertained Servants over the years
IV. The Transitions of Chateau sur Mer’s Domestic Areas..................................28-43 The 1870s-1880s: Evolution of the new service wing Appropriate existing and non-existing objects Early 20th Century remodeling Appropriate existing and non-existing objects
V. Chateau sur Mer Timeline..............................................................................44-45 VI. Floor Plans VII. Exhibits and Figures VIII. Sources Consulted
